NSStackViewDelegate
Сконфигурировать пользовательский класс для ответа на представление, отсоединяющееся от или повторно прикрепляющее к, представление штабеля (экземпляр NSStackView класс), сконфигурируйте пользовательский класс для принятия NSStackViewDelegate протокол. Затем в экземпляре представления штабеля, набор delegate свойство для обращения к экземпляру пользовательского класса.
Для объяснения отсоединения и прикрепления штабеля представления представления, см. Обзор в Ссылке класса NSStackView.
Наследование
Не применимый
Оператор импорта
Swift
import AppKit
Objective C
@import AppKit;
Доступность
Доступный в OS X v10.9 и позже.
-
Вызванный, когда представление штабеля автоматически повторно прикрепило один или несколько ранее-независимых-взглядов.
Объявление
Swift
optional func stackView(_stackView: NSStackView, didReattachViewsviews: [AnyObject])Objective C
- (void)stackView:(NSStackView *)stackViewdidReattachViews:(NSArray *)viewsПараметры
stackViewПредставление штабеля, повторно прикрепившее один или несколько независимых взглядов.
viewsМассив одного или более представлений, которыми управляет представление штабеля, которые были повторно прикреплены.
Обсуждение
Для конфигурирования пользовательского класса для ответа на автоматическое прикрепление представлений к иерархии представления представления штабеля реализуйте этот метод в классе. Когда Ваш код явно добавляет представление к представлению штабеля, этот метод не вызывают
viewsмассив.Оператор импорта
Objective C
@import AppKit;Swift
import AppKitДоступность
Доступный в OS X v10.9 и позже.
-
Вызванный, когда представление штабеля собирается автоматически отсоединиться один или больше его представлений.
Объявление
Swift
optional func stackView(_stackView: NSStackView, willDetachViewsviews: [AnyObject])Objective C
- (void)stackView:(NSStackView *)stackViewwillDetachViews:(NSArray *)viewsПараметры
stackViewПредставление штабеля, собирающееся отсоединиться один или больше его представлений.
viewsМассив одного или более представлений, которыми управляет представление штабеля, которые собираются быть автоматически отсоединенными.
Обсуждение
Для конфигурирования пользовательского класса для ответа на автоматическое отсоединение представлений от иерархии представления представления штабеля реализуйте этот метод в классе. Когда Ваш код явно удаляет представление из представления штабеля, этот метод не вызывают
viewsмассив.Оператор импорта
Objective C
@import AppKit;Swift
import AppKitДоступность
Доступный в OS X v10.9 и позже.
